About my yard I only sit in the client's home, not at my own. This allows the pet to feel more comfortable in their own environment. No travel trauma for pet or owner. Reduced chance for picking up illness as not boarding with other pets. Pets can keep their same feeding & exercise routines. They can also have the familiar sights, sounds & smells that make them feel safe in their own home. You can’t always predict a super busy day at work, but you can anticipate your dog’s needs. Instead of rushing home at lunch, book a dog walker to give your dog a 30- or 60-minute dog walk. Your dog walker can stop by as many times as you need—on whatever days you need them. With the Rover app, get a comprehensive Rover Card from your dog walker that includes:
- Start and stop times
- A map of their walk with total distance
- Pee, poo, food, and water breaks
- Cute photos and a personalized note
